This petition was submitted by Xander Ashwell, having collected 521 online and 623 on paper, making for a total of 1,144 signatures.

 

Text of petition:

NRW’s own reports confirm Bryn Posteg is a "Significant" risk. In 2025 alone, the site recorded methane levels of 84% (safety limit 1%) and discharged solids into the Nant Y Bradnant at 140x the legal limit. Officers were forced to abandon checks in specific zones due to dangerous gas levels triggering their personal safety alarms. Despite being labelled the "worst performing landfill in Wales," pollution continues, impacting local residents. We demand intervention to prevent irreversible damage

 

Additional information:

Evidence from Natural Resources Wales (2024–2025, https://publicregister.naturalresources.wales) shows Bryn Posteg Landfill is in systemic collapse, endangering public safety and the environment.

1. Severe River Pollution: In Nov 2025, the site discharged sediment into the Nant Y Bradnant at 7,050 mg/l - 140 times the legal limit (50 mg/l) (Ref: CAR_NRW0050076). Despite orders to install a bund, inspectors found in Dec 2025 that no barrier was built.

2. Gas Risk: Methane levels at the site perimeter consistently hit 84% (Ref: CAR_NRW0049850), far exceeding the 1% safety limit. Gas migration is now so severe that in April 2025, NRW officers were forced to abandon an area when personal gas alarms were triggered.

3. Impact to local residents is severe, with daily smell nuisances trapping people indoors, fearing for water safety and dangerous gas migration.

NRW calls this the "worst performing landfill in Wales." We demand urgent action from NRW and a transparent remediation plan.
